A General Engineering Company, A General Engineering Contractor in San Francisco, CA
A General Engineering Company operating as a corporation holds an active California contractor license (CSLB #1038031), valid through Apr 30, 2028. First issued in 2018, the license has been on the CSLB roster for 8 years. It carries a single CSLB classification: A — General Engineering Contractor. Records show an active surety bond on file with American Contractors Indemnity Company and active workers' compensation coverage from State Compensation Insurance Fund. The business is based in San Francisco, in San Francisco County, California.
